Marco Polo entertains the aging Kublai Khan with tales of the fantastical cities he has visited throughout the emperor's vast domain. Each city is a poetic meditation on memory, desire, signs, and the hidden structures of human experience. Through 55 luminous prose poems, Calvino constructs an intricate exploration of how we understand and inhabit the places we call home.
